Ikuru, Secondus Admits Wike Has A Very Bad Case at The Election Tribunal, lawyers Search For Technicality.

Tele-Ikuru and PDP national Chairman Uche Secondus lament over Nyesom wike the care taker Governor having a bad case at the election tribunal, they have began to plan how to rigg the next election.

ACTING NATIONAL CHAIRMAN OF PDP, PRINCE UCHE SECONDUS; FORMER DEPUTY GOVERNOR OF RIVERS STATE, ENGR. TELE IKURU MAY DUMP CHIEF NYESOM WIKE.

In a move which was described as “very shocking”, a source very close to the former Deputy Governor of Rivers State, Engr. Tele Ikuru has revealed that Engr. Ikuru admitted to few of his confidants and kinsmen that the PDP in Rivers State has a very bad case. The source also revealed that Prince Uche Secondus reasons in the same manner. Tele said “PDP has a bad case. Our lawyers said so, but that they would see what they can do technically…but that it is a very very bad case”
When asked if Prince Secondus was aware and what it meant for their political family he said, “uncle is aware and he is doing something about it. Be rest assured that we will not lose out. Since 1999, have we lost out? The family will not lose out. Even when it seemed that we would lose out in 2007, did we lose? Did we lose out in the Deputy National Chairman of the Party? Even when Amaechi was sponsoring another candidate, I was there with him, I didn’t make noise because I knew that Prince Uche Secondus can never lose out. He gets what he wants. Didn’t we get the speaker?”

What the source considered shocking were his subsequent comments. According to the source who insisted on anonymity, the former deputy governor, who also betrayed his first principal, Sir Celestine Omehia, was quoted as saying that “if Wike is removed today, Ikuniyi would still be the Speaker, the Acting Governor that would conduct the election, we can use that to negotiate with the stronger party, whether PDP or APC”. When he was reminded that Ikunyi may also lose his case and not returned in the House, he said “the Speakers case will end at the Court of Appeal, which will be maximum 8 months, but Wike’s case will take another 2 months in the Supreme Court. So Wike will be in office when the House of Assembly Election will be conducted so Ikuniyi would win again and will be returned as Speaker. As Speaker he would negotiate the future of the family when the time comes, just be rest assured the family will not lose” but they seemed to forget that the police which was instrumental to their election victory will not be available for them again.

The game of wits has just started in the PDP; only time will tell the winner.
